HUNTER SAFETY REQUIREMENTS
No person born on or after January 1, 1966 (Wyoming) or January 1, 1985 (Montana) may take any wildlife by the use of firearms, unless that person possesses and can exhibit a certificate of competency and safety in the use and handling of firearms. Wyoming and Montana both grant reciprocity to other states, countries and provinces providing recognized hunter safety certificates. Exhibit of certificates is not required to apply for or obtain a license. Certificates must be carried into the field. The minimum age to hunt in Wyoming and Montana is 12.

TAXIDERMY - TROPHY CARE - MEAT PROCESSING
When your buck is bagged, your guide will take care of the field dressing. Taxidermy work and meat processing are available locally. The cost of taxidermy and meat processing is your responsibility. If you can't take the meat home, it can be donated to a local food bank. Note that the cost is still your responsibility. Meat cutting charges run $80 and up depending on customer preference plus the cost of dry ice and shipping boxes. Taxidermy work is approximately $500 and up for a shoulder mount plus crating and shipping. European mounts are $200+.

Heads left to be caped, boxed and shipped to you by local taxidermists are your responsibility. If you want to take your head home to a local taxidermist, this can also be arranged. Antelope heads can be frozen and packed in a box with your meat. Heads taken home by commercial airlines require special care. Please call your airline in advance to acquaint yourself with current airline requirements. In addition, be sure to familiarize yourself to state laws regarding transporting meat and heads with regard to regulations around chronic wasting disease.
